About this property

Approximately 26.1 acres with no restrictions and outside city limits in Commerce. Improved pasture land with sandy loam currently leased for cattle. 2 ponds and a few trees are on this section. Red boundary lines are approximate. It has not been surveyed out of the larger tract yet so more acreage is available for a total of up to approximately 44.567 acres. This portion would be fenced on three sides once surveyed out. A 30 feet wide x75 feet long equipment shed that was built in 2016 is on this section. The shed entrance height is 12 feet and peak height is 14 feet with no interior obstructions. A water line is at the road and another runs through the property but no meter is installed. Electricity is available nearby. A small portion in the front is in the flood plain. Property has been owned and well maintained by one family for the last 62 years. See additional MLS listings for information on the total acreage available. CATTLE ON THE PROPERTY.

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
